Abstract

Official abstract text for this publication.

This document provides aquaretic and natriuretic polypeptides. For example, this document provides polypeptides having aquaretic and/or natriuretic activities. In some cases, a polypeptide provided herein can have aquaretic and natriuretic activities, while lacking the ability to lower blood pressure. This document also provides methods and materials for inducing aquaretic and/or natriuretic activities within a mammal.

First claim

Opening claim text (preview).

What is claimed is: 1. A natriuretic polypeptide less than 45 amino acid residues in length, wherein said polypeptide comprises, in an order from amino terminus to carboxy terminus: (a) the sequence set forth in SEQ ID NO:2, and (b) the sequence set forth in SEQ ID NO:3. 2. The polypeptide of claim 1 , wherein said polypeptide has natriuretic activity. 3. The polypeptide of claim 1 , wherein said polypeptide lacks vasodilatory activity. 4. The polypeptide of claim 1 , wherein said polypeptide lacks the sequence set forth in SEQ ID NO:1. 5. The polypeptide of claim 1 , wherein said polypeptide comprises the sequence set forth in SEQ ID NO:8. 6. The polypeptide of claim 1 , wherein said polypeptide consists of the sequence set forth in SEQ ID NO:8. 7. A pharmaceutical composition comprising a pharmaceutically acceptable carrier and a natriuretic polypeptide less than 45 amino acid residues in length, wherein said polypeptide comprises, in an order from amino terminus to carboxy terminus: (a) the sequence set forth in SEQ ID NO:2, and (b) the sequence set forth in SEQ ID NO:3. 8. A method for increasing aquaretic and natriuretic activity within a mammal without lowering blood pressure, wherein said method comprises administering to said mammal a natriuretic polypeptide less than 45 amino acid residues in length, wherein said polypeptide comprises, in an order from amino terminus to carboxy terminus: (a) the sequence set forth in SEQ ID NO:2, and (b) the sequence set forth in SEQ ID NO:3. 9.
